How is Gateway Tutoring Delivered?

Tutoring is available to students by individual appointment as well as group/walk-in sessions.

Please refer to the Tutoring Schedule for available sessions. For writing assistance specifically, choose the "English and Humanities" tutor option. 

If students need assistance outside of the Gateway Writing Tutor's availability, students have Brainfuse as an option for 24/7 help.

How to Make an Appointment with Gateway Tutoring

If students would prefer to make an appointment with a tutor, that can be done via email found on the tutoring schedule website, or through Starfish with the directions below.

  1. Login to MyPath
  2. Click on "Starfish" as one of the icon buttons.
  3. Click on “My Success Network."
  4. Click on "Tutoring – Center for Academic Success."
  5. Click on “Schedule appointment” for a list of all available tutors’ office hours. If you know which tutor you need, click on the profile for the open office hours. Click "Schedule Appointment."
  6. Find an available time and click "Sign Up."
  7. Choose your appointment type (Tutoring) and add a few details for your tutor (we suggest your student ID number, phone number, and goal for meeting), then click “Submit”
  8. Find your upcoming appointments on the Starfish “Home” screen.

Brainfuse Writing Tutors: 24/7 online resource!

Steps to Use Brainfuse

  1. Go to your Blackboard course.
  2. Click on the Student Support and Resources folder.
  3. Scroll to the link that says "Click Here for Free Online Tutoring powered by Brainfuse"
  4. Choose the option under "Writing Lab" to submit your paper.
  5. Meet with a live tutor or schedule a time.
